Curlbox December 2014 Subscription Box Review!

/home/wpcom/public_html/wp-content/blogs.dir/cb2/60404265/files/2014/12/img_7020.jpg


Curlbox 


Cost: $20 per month plus shipping


What is Curlbox?


Naturally curly women have their hands full with trying to maintain our tousled waves and decadent curls. Now curly haired girls of all textures can experience new and even cutting edge products every month; shipped directly to your home. No more worrying about that overwhelming feeling when looking at all the choices in the isles and isles of products in every store, because now you can rest assured that every month affordable products will arrive like clock work every month on your doorstep! Every month subscribers will receive 5-7 hair products (a mix of Full and sample sized products).


Since I am trying to revert my hair back. to its natural curly state I need all the help I can get, so I am trying Curlbox for the first time! My children also have coarse and thick textured curly hair so we all go through tons of hair products, which can be very expensive when you are experimenting on new hair remedies.

Included in every box is a quick reference guide that includes a letter from the editor and run down of the items included.


/home/wpcom/public_html/wp-content/blogs.dir/cb2/60404265/files/2014/12/img_7023.jpg


Creme of Nature Straight from Eden Plant-Derived repairing oil (Full Size) $8.99 and Detangling leave-in conditioner (Full Size) $9.95


Creme of Nature has been one of those products that has been around for years and has constantly evolved with the changing times. The new Straight from Eden Plant-Derived Conditioning Treatments are made with plant-derived ingredients like coconut, avocado, and olive oil to rejuvenate & fortify all hair types! Best yet… these products contain no sulfates, Parabens, or alcohol!

Elasta QP Olive Oil Mango Butter Conditioner (15 oz/ Full Size) $5.99


The Mango Butter smells divine and is supposed to add strength and shine to damaged hair. This product is said to be great for natural, braided and even straight styles and has some pretty awesome reviews!

Ouidad Curl Recovery Defining Styling Souffle (0.6 fl oz) $1.80, Curly Hair Solutions Curl Keeper Original (1 fl oz) $2.94, &


Curly Hair Solutions Curl Keeper(1 fl oz) $1.12


These samples will last a few days each depending on how you store them. I have tried Ouidad before, but Curly Hair has been on my wishlist ever since Birchbox did a post about curly hair and this was one of the products many reviewers raved about. I can’t wait to finally try this out for myself!


All-in-all I am impressed with my first box! I paid around $20 plus shipping for my box and received around $30 in hair products! I especially like that the bulk of the items are full sized which really gives you some bang for your buck. If you are a hair product junkie than this may be the box for you!
